I can't see why you brits go so mad with your scoobysport stuff. Every scoobysport piece I've seen was utter garbage. My favourite garage had a TB exhaust imported and it looked like it was fashioned by a 14 year old with a big hammer. The welds were really poor and there was even a leak where they didn't weld a seam completely.
Thinking the item was dammaged during shipping and possibly just an odd defective unit they shipped it back for a replacement. The replacement although it had no leaks wasn't really any better. This made my decision to install a 3" MRT exhaust which I might add was very well done and the welds on my unit look like artwork.
My only other experience with scoobysport is a hoodscoop that they made and sent. It was supposed to be carbon fiber but turned out to be fiberglass with CF on top. The fiber wasn't laid evenly and was stretched and distorted. Scoobysport was even told this was for a show car. Utterly unusable.
Maybe you guys being closer to Scoobysport get better quality stuff or maybe these 3 occurrences were just flukes? I'm surprised so many recommend them after what I've seen.

To be fair, I can't see any of my scoobysport exhaust apart from the tail pipe which when polished looks good (ie, whether the welds look good or not isn't an issue)
I think scoobysport recommendations are based mainly on sound. When I did have an issue with my backbox, there were no questions and no charges. All very professional.
